Ox Club occupies the ground floor of Headrow House, a converted mill that also contains a beer hall and cocktail bar — a multi-storey venue that represents the best of Leeds's ambition. The restaurant centres on a wood-fired grill imported from the United States, around which chef Ben Davy has built a menu that is simultaneously primal and sophisticated.

The Michelin Guide listing recognises a kitchen that knows exactly what it is doing with flame. Dry-aged steaks are the headliners — Yorkshire-sourced, hung on site, and cooked with the kind of confidence that comes from having done it ten thousand times. But Ox Club is not merely a steakhouse: seasonal vegetables from the grill, sharing boards of aged charcuterie, and a Sunday roast that combines traditional comfort with technical precision demonstrate a kitchen range that earns the room's reputation.

The wine list runs to several hundred bottles with particular depth in Burgundy and Rhône. The cocktail programme upstairs is excellent if you want to extend the evening. Ox Club is the room Leeds reaches for when the city wants to impress — and it does not disappoint.

Best Occasion Fit

Ox Club is Leeds's strongest choice for team dinners. The sharing-focused menu generates natural conversation, the beer hall atmosphere upstairs accommodates a group's pre-dinner energy, and the cooking is crowd-pleasing enough for mixed palates without ever being dull.
